How about this. Fortune Pond, mid to late July. The Sand Dog event would be held at Fortune Pond itself Friday afternoon, Saturday and Sunday Morning. July is the one time of year where you have a better then average chance on getting out on lake Michigan and/or Superior. Just like Sand Dog in Florida, a lot of the divers come a day or two early and dive other places other then the main event. Perhaps those interested could do a charter out of Milwaukee and dive the Car ferry S S Milwaukee, ( https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/SS_Milwaukee ) or the Prince Willem, (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=16bM3uWDJAk ) .
The water will be cold. No getting around that. Surface, low 60's Fortune Pond, anywhere from the high 40's to the low 60's on Lake Michigan. At depth, low 40's either way. The viz at Fortune will be the worst of the year. That being said, it will FAR surpass any other quarries best viz period. Lake Michigan on the deeper wrecks should be at least 50 feet. Viz of 100 or better in not uncommon.
Base of operation would be in Iron River Michigan about eleven miles from Fortune pond. Crystal Falls where Fortune Pond is located offers little in amenities.
